Purchasing the replacement of doors and windows can yield various benefits:
Energy Efficiency: New windows and doors frequently include sophisticated insulation features and low-emissivity (Low-E) glass finishings that reduce heating & cooling expenses.
Enhanced Curb Appeal: Updated doors and windows enhance the total look of a home, considerably increasing curb appeal and home value.
Improved Security: Many contemporary designs include innovative locking systems and durable products, offering increased defense versus burglaries.
Sound Reduction: Replacement windows can produce a quieter indoor environment by efficiently obstructing outside sound.
Reduced Maintenance: Modern products such as vinyl and fiberglass need less upkeep compared to conventional wood.
When to Consider Replacement
Understanding when to change doors and windows is important for property owners. Indicators include:
Visible Damage: Cracks, chips, or warping can compromise the effectiveness of windows and doors.Drafts: Noticing drafts around doors and windows can suggest failing seals and insulation.Increasing Energy Bills: Increasing energy costs, especially during severe temperatures, might indicate ineffective doors and windows.Hard Operation: Difficulty in opening or closing windows and doors is an indication of malfunctioning hardware or warping.Windows And Door Replacement Process

For how long does the replacement procedure take?
The time required depends on the number of doors and windows being replaced. A single window or door setup might take a few hours, while a full-home replacement could take a number of days.
Can I set up new windows myself?
While DIY setup is possible, it needs skill and experience. Hiring a professional is frequently advised for best outcomes and warranty coverage.
What are Low-E windows?
Low-E (low emissivity) windows are created to reduce heat transfer, keeping homes cooler in summer season and warmer in winter season, thus enhancing energy effectiveness.
